Crystal structure of 2,5-dihydroxyterephthalic acid from powder diffraction data
The crystal structure of anhydrous 2,5-dhydroxyterephthalic acid, C8H6O6, was solved and refined using laboratory X-ray powder diffraction data, and optimized using density functional techniques.
